Kakamega Tragedy: Wife, Three Children Allegedly Kill Husband For Returning Home Late
A family in Shinyalu is mourning the loss of one of their own following a tragic domestic incident that has left the community in shock.
The dispute, involving a man, his wife, and their three children, ended in the unfortunate death of the family patriarch.
The deceased, identified as Magnos Lumiti, is reported to have died as a result of an assault allegedly carried out by his wife, Olivia Shitsiali, with the assistance of their three children.
The tragic events unfolded after a confrontation between Lumiti and Shitsiali concerning her late return home.
According to a report by K24, Lumiti questioned his wife about her whereabouts and the reason for coming home late, which reportedly triggered a violent reaction.
Shitsiali allegedly struck Lumiti on the head during the confrontation, leaving him unconscious. It is further alleged that their three children joined in the assault, ultimately leading to Lumiti’s untimely death.

Family members of the deceased have spoken out, expressing long-standing concerns regarding Shitsiali’s behavior.
They claim that despite repeated warnings about her movements and conduct, Shitsiali paid no heed. “The deceased’s wife is always walking around. We’ve warned her so many times, but she doesn’t listen. Our uncle has died because of her,” one relative told K24.
Following the incident, Lumiti’s family has resolved that Shitsiali is no longer welcome at the family homestead. They have accused her of contributing directly to the death of Lumiti and view her presence as unwelcome and disrespectful in the aftermath of such a loss.
The grieving family is now calling upon the government to intervene and ensure that justice is served.
They are pleading for legal action to be taken against Shitsiali and for support in navigating the profound loss they have suffered. “We are pleading with the government to help us. We cannot see the future now that he is dead. Our in-law had refused to be questioned about where she was coming from,” another family member lamented.
As investigations continue, the community watches closely, hoping that the matter will be thoroughly examined and that appropriate action will be taken to deliver justice for the late Magnos Lumiti.
